My Buying Guides on Donut Iron On Patch
What I Look for First
When I shop for a donut iron on patch, the first thing I check is the overall design. I want the donut to look fun, clear, and colorful, with details like sprinkles, frosting, or a cute expression if it has one. I also pay attention to the size because I want the patch to fit nicely on jackets, backpacks, jeans, hats, or tote bags without looking too small or too oversized.
Patch Quality and Material
For me, the quality of the patch matters a lot. I usually prefer patches made with strong embroidery and neat stitching because they tend to last longer and look better over time. I also check whether the patch has a sturdy iron-on backing, since that makes application easier. If the material feels flimsy or the edges look messy, I usually skip it.
Easy Application
I always consider how easy it will be to apply the patch. A good donut iron on patch should attach smoothly with a household iron and stay in place after cooling. I like when the seller gives clear instructions, including heat settings and pressing time. If I plan to use it on thicker fabric, I make sure it can handle that without peeling off too quickly.
Durability and Washability
Durability is important to me because I want the patch to stay looking good after regular use. I look for patches that can handle washing without fraying, fading, or lifting at the corners. In my experience, it helps if the patch is sewn on after ironing, especially for items I wash often like jackets or bags.
Style and Personal Use
I usually choose a donut patch based on where I want to use it. If I want something playful, I go for bright colors and cute designs. If I want a more subtle look, I pick a smaller patch with softer tones. I also think about whether I want one patch as a statement piece or several patches to create a themed look.
Back Type and Attachment Options
I always check whether the patch is iron-on only or if it can also be sewn on. For me, having both options is a big advantage because ironing gives quick application, while sewing adds extra security. Some patches also come with adhesive backing, but I usually prefer a strong iron-on layer for better long-term use.
Price and Value
When I compare prices, I don’t just look for the cheapest option. I look for the best value. A slightly more expensive patch is worth it to me if the embroidery is cleaner, the colors are brighter, and the backing is stronger. I usually compare a few options before deciding so I can get something that looks great and lasts.
Where I Prefer to Use It
I think about the item I want to decorate before buying. Donut iron on patches work great on denim jackets, canvas bags, caps, shirts, and kids’ clothing. I make sure the fabric can handle heat and that the patch size matches the item. For delicate fabrics, I usually avoid iron-on patches unless I can sew them on carefully.
